Outline of a solution
A U.S.–China framework to resolve the TikTok standoff has taken shape, with Oracle among firms positioned to enable U.S. operations if the deal is finalized. Details remain fluid, and approvals would likely be needed in Washington and Beijing. A looming deadline could be extended to allow the structure to close.
Ownership, data and politics
Congress previously mandated divestiture over data-security concerns and influence risks. Any solution will aim to shift control and hosting to U.S. entities, with third-party oversight for code and data access. The company’s 170 million U.S. users make continuity a major political and commercial consideration.
Call planned between Xi and Trump
Officials signalled a leader-level call to confirm the framework. Markets are watching whether the plan satisfies hawks in Congress and addresses Beijing’s sensitivities over tech sovereignty—two hurdles that sank prior fixes.
Bangladesh and creator economy
For Bangladeshi creators and brands selling into the U.S., clarity on TikTok’s status matters for ad spend, affiliate sales, and cross-border campaigns. A credible framework could steady performance marketing plans into the holiday season.
